Rekeying a car is excellent way to keep your vehicle in good working order. Rekeying costs can vary. It's usually cheaper than replacing a complete lock.

If you have lost your keys, or you have been the victim of theft the best solution could be to have them rekeyed. This way, your key will still work, but the person with the key will not be able to get into your car. Check with your insurance company to find out if they'll cover the cost of rekeying in the event that you lose your key.

If you want to rekey a car, you will need a professional locksmith. This will involve changing the tumbler and wafer settings of the lock, as well as replacing the key pins.

Rekeying cars is an inexpensive procedure. In general, the cost is about $75 to $180 for a single car and this includes the labor. This type of rekeying can be a good investment since it safeguards your vehicle, and prevents you from unwelcome surprises.

An effective method to determine whether you should rekey or replace your locks is to look at your budget. The cost of replacing locks is higher than rekeying, as you'll have to pay for parts and labor.

You can speak with an mobile auto locksmiths shop to have your car rekeyed. Depending on the location the cost for rekeying a car may range from $50-$200. The cost will differ in relation to the quality of service you receive.

Rekeying your car can save you money. Typically the cost of rekeying consists of taking out the lock cylinder and replacing the tumblers and installing a new lock cylinder with a new combination. However, if you've got damaged locks, rekeying may not be an option.

Smart keys are now the new remotes that do not require keys.

If you're a car owner, you've probably seen that more and more cars are equipped with smart keys. With a single click you can lock, unlock, or start your car. It is a convenient and safe method of driving.

Automakers are increasingly using these keys, and they are becoming popular. Many cars come with a keyless entry system that comes with a small remote you can put in your pocket or purse. It's a wireless radio transmitter that sends out a code which can be used to unlock the doors of the engine or trunk.

Certain models have push-start technology. These cars are offered by numerous major car manufacturers around the world for an extended period of time. However, they're becoming more common on basic models.

The technology will be improved and keys will be able do more for you. You'll have the ability to control the temperature inside your car, open the windows, and remotely start your engine.

While these technologies are convenient but they're also complicated. Smart key systems can fail due to a variety of reasons. For instance, cheap auto locksmith near me it can stop working if the battery is blown or gets too wet. To resolve the issue, you'll need to take your vehicle to a mechanic.

In some instances your key might need to be programmed in order to work. This can be done by your dealer, or locksmith.

Although smart keys are able to do many things that traditional keys can, they're not burglar-proof. Depending on the way you use your keys, you could be able set your alarm. Other features include panic alerts and the possibility of unlocking your vehicle remotely.

Repairing a damaged ignition module

If you notice that your car is has stopped working properly, or have difficulty starting it, it might be time to check the ignition module. This component is crucial to the functioning of your vehicle. This component is responsible for monitoring the timing and the strength of the spark that is used to start the engine.

The ignition module could fail due to a variety of reasons. The most common reason is an engine that is too hot. Some other causes include shorts, corrosion, and poor electrical connections to the spark plug.

You'll need tools to examine the ignition module for imperfections. A multimeter can be used to check the voltage entering the module. You can also test the voltage using the light timing tester.

You can refer to an automobile repair manual if you are not sure how to conduct the test. A schematic is provided in the majority of service manuals to aid you in understanding the components.

An ignition module is a small electronic device that controls the ignition of the spark plug. A malfunctioning or broken ignition module can cause your vehicle to stall or lose power. It is also responsible for detecting and reporting any errors. This could lead to costly repairs. Be sure to read the repair manual thoroughly.

It is recommended that you get your ignition repaired as quickly as possible if you notice problems. A malfunctioning ignition module risky, but it could also cause you to be stranded. Getting a faulty module repaired can prevent other damage from occurring.
